A Turning Point in Oil Spill Recovery

(Photo: Elastec)

Cleaning up marine oil spills can be a challenge as there are various types of oil spilled but only a few effective recovery methods. The three main technologies for oil spill recovery for inland and offshore waters are mechanical, insitu burning (ISB), and dispersant application. Absorbent booms and pads may also be used, but they are more effective for small fuel spills. Mechanical recovery, usually an oil skimmer, is a device that skims contained floating oil and transfers the recovered oil to a storage container or vessel.

Norwegian Shelf Subsea Contract for Aker Solutions

Aker Solutions wins a topside modification contract by Statoil to increase oil recovery at Gullfaks South. Estimated contract value is NOK 180 million. The main object of the project is to deliver topside modification for tie-in of two new templates, located at Gullfaks South, to Gullfaks A, plus topside modification for re-routing production from existing template D from Gullfaks A to Gullfaks C. Scope of work under the Gullfaks South increased oil recovery topside project includes engineering, procurement, construction, installation and commissioning assistance (EPCIc). New Contract for Aker Solutions and BP Norway

Aker Solutions secures maintenance and modifications contract with BP Norway. BP has decided to extend the maintenance and modification contract with Aker Solutions, exercising an option in the existing agreement for the Ula, Valhall, Skarv, Hod and Tambar fields. Scope of work under the contract includes maintenance support services and brownfield modification projects covering engineering, procurement, fabrication and offshore installation. The contract currently employs approximately 200 people in Stavanger, 20 in Egersund and 300 in offshore rotation. Maintenance and modifications work will help to increase oil recovery rate and extend the life of BP's fields.

Hays Awarded Statoil Research Prize

Curtis Hays Whitson together with Morten Loktu (left), Statoil’s head of research, and Margareth Øvrum, executive vice president for Technology & New Energy. (Photo courtesy Statoil)

Professor Curtis Hays Whitson has been awarded Statoil’s research prize 2010 for his major input to boosting knowledge about recovery of gas and gas condensate fields and improved recovery of oil fields by the use of gas injection. The prominent researcher came to Norway in the early 1980s. As professor and entrepreneur he has conducted numerous studies for Hydro and Statoil in connection with field implementation of gas injection on the Norwegian continental shelf (NCS) and internationally, as well as studies related to gas field recovery and phase behaviour of reservoirs.
